Limitations law

The statute of limitations in the law of car accidents is the maximum time one can sue for damages. This limitation is based on the state and type of lawsuit, but it generally is three years from the date of the accident.

This deadline is not applicable to injuries that were caused by an intentional act. It is important to remember that the negligence or omissions of the party who was injured do not count as limitations.

The time limit in North Carolina for most personal injuries claims, including car accident cases , is 3 years. This means you must file your claim before this date except if the court extends that time.

It is possible that your claim is dismissed if submit a claim for Roswell Car Accident Law Firm accident-related damages after the statute of limitations has expired. This will prevent the claim from being made for the compensation you're entitled to for your injuries or losses.

Care duty

To be able to pursue a personal injury case you must first establish that someone else owed you obligations. This is among the most crucial factors in any car accident case.

The legal term "duty of care" defines the obligation each person has to protect other people from suffering. It's a social contract between individuals and is the foundation of the majority of personal injury lawsuits.

All drivers owe fellow road users a duty to be safe and obey traffic laws. They could be held responsible for any injuries they cause when they fail to follow this.

Similarly, doctors have a duty to ensure that their patients are not injured while they are under their care. This can mean a number of things like taking a medical history and addressing the concerns of patients.

To determine if a doctor was negligent, you must demonstrate that they did not meet the standard of care that a reasonable person would have followed in your specific circumstance. This can be a challenging task however your attorney can help you determine the best way to proceed.

A connection with the defendant could be used to establish a duty. For instance, let's say you ride the bus to work every day. Your relationship with the bus driver implies that they are bound by a duty of care, and if they violated this duty by running a red light while using their mobile and you decide to sue them, they could be sued for negligence.

If you've proved that the defendant owed you the duty of care, it's now time to prove they failed to fulfill the duty. This is often easier than you think, especially when it comes to an accident in the car.

If you've established that the defendant acted in violation of their duty of care, you now need to prove that the actions they took caused your injuries. Damages

The law governing car accidents was enacted to pay victims of negligent drivers for injuries they sustained. These damages are in the form of reimbursement for medical bills as well as lost income and property damage. They also cover other damages, such as the suffering of others, loss of enjoyment of life and even punitive damages for reckless conduct that exhibited total disregard for the safety of others.

The damages you get in a car crash case will vary from person person. This is due to a variety of factors, such as the nature and severity of your injuries.

For example, back injuries can cause permanent damage that is difficult to quantify than injuries resulting from internal organs. Whiplash can also have emotional and fhoy.kr physical implications that are difficult to quantify.

Whatever damages you receive there are certain rules that apply. These include the "comparative fault" rule, which will reduce the amount of your settlement if partially at fault for the accident.

When the jury decides on how you should be compensated, they will consider the level of your responsibility for the incident. If you were speeding at the time of the accident and the jury determines that you're at least 40% responsible the amount you receive will be 60 percent of the total amount.
